Approximate Timetable of Prenatal Development Prenatal Development is divided into 3 trimesters. 1st two months the developing human is called an embryo – from which all body organs develop 2nd trimester he/she is called a fetus. The 3rd trimester the baby is growing and could survive with medical care if born prematurely. Ultrasound picture

It is divided into Trimesters (3) How Long is Pregnancy? The “average” pregnancy lasts approximately 40 weeks. That really is more like 9 ½ months than 9 months. Babies born before 37 weeks are premature and those born after 42 weeks are post mature It’s better to measure pregnancy in weeks than in months It is divided into Trimesters (3)

Where does life begin? Scientifically – When the ovum and sperm meet and the ovum (egg) becomes fertilized it is both human – and alive. So – the answer really is that life begins at conception. This normally happens in the fallopian tubes. The fertilized ovum then moves to the uterus where it should implant to continue growing and maturing

First Trimester 1st – 12th week 8 wks First month – early formation of the layers of cells that become the organs Amniotic sac forms – (water) By the end, the embryo is about ¼” Second month Grows to about 1 ½”. Bones and muscles round out contours of body, forehead prominent, heart begins beating, limbs elongate, sex organs begin to form

First Trimester 3rd month Beginning of “fetal” period Male sexual organs showing more rapidly than female Tooth buds for all 20 baby teeth Organs begin functioning Movement of arms, legs, shoulders, and fingers possible Mother will not feel the movement yet. 3.5 months

Second Trimester 4th – 6th months (13th week to 26th week) Lower parts of body grow rapidly so that head appears more normal Back straightens, hands and feet well formed. More movement – begins to be felt by mother 5th month Skin structures attain final form, sweat and sebaceous (oil) glands functioning. Hair, nails on fingers and toes Lean and wrinkled About 1 foot long and weighs about 1 pound ↑ 4 mos ↓ 5mos

2nd trimester 6th month Eyelids which were fused shut, reopen. Eyes are completely formed Taste buds on tongue (more than we have!) Development mostly over – growth to occur now. Would have chance if born after 24 weeks

Third Trimester 27th week to birth 7th month Capable of living from this point Baby can respond to light, music, sound About 15” long, 3 lbs 8th and 9th month Time to “fatten up”! Formation finished. Lots of movement and activity! Rapid fetal heart rate
